Is the work ethic still viable as society evolves? This book engages with widespread current anxieties about the future of work and its place in a fulfilled human life. It is a philosophical treatment of the nature of work and reconsiders the aims and procedures of education. The author calls for a reshaping of school as the work culture has come to know it.

Magnificently illustrated and superbly written, this book offers a systematic approach to describing the thirty-five tree species which make up ninety per cent of the woodland and forest trees in Britain. Beginning with helpful introductory material and an illustrated identification key, the book proceeds to non-technical tree-by-tree descriptions of each species' origins, history, natural range and distribution, growth and management requirements, and uses. The beautiful color photographs and illustrations that supplement the text range from leaves and shoots to whole trees, flowers, and fruits. A glossary of technical terms is included for readers approaching the subject for the first time. Forest and Woodland Trees in Britain will delight all readers with an interest in natural history, forestry, arboriculture, landscape design, and environmental studies.
